In today's episode, Loraine is discussing the often taboo subject of domestic abuse with guest Samantha Billingham. Sam, a survivor of domestic abuse, shares her personal experiences and the work she has done to support others in similar situations. She talks about setting up support groups like SODA (Survivors of Domestic Abuse) and raising awareness about coercive control through the MTAB (More Than a Bruise) campaign. Sam also shares her upcoming training as an Independent Domestic Violence Advisor (IDVA) to further support survivors and victims of domestic abuse. Together, Sam and Loraine delve into the challenges of reporting abuse, the impact on mental health, and the journey towards healing and forgiveness.

HOST BIO

Loraine is a blogger, digital creator, and author.
A former Property Management business owner spent a decade in HMO and family rentals before moving to Spain in 2016 with dreams of becoming fully retired and living in Spain with her partner, but that dream shattered in September 2020.

Loraine explains how she has now experienced the three D's in relationship endings. Divorce, death of a partner and now discard, the abrupt termination of a relationship.

Currently working on rebuilding her life whilst living with three overlapping litigations post-separation including the threat of precarious eviction by a former partner.
